The significance of root canal treatment becomes imperative for treating infected or damaged nerves or blood vessels. During the procedure, the damaged pulp is removed & the inside of the tooth is cleaned & sealed. This is necessary because bacteria and other dying remnants of the pulp can cause infection & swelling on the face & neck, further resulting in adverse outcomes.

Some of the common signs to consult the root canal dentist in rock hill SC are:  

  • Sensitivity to hot & cold water, 
  • Severe pain while chewing or biting, 
  • Chipped or cracked tooth,
  • Tender or swollen gum, and 
  • Decaying or darkening of gums.
How does the root canal treatment begin? Apex Dentist in Rock Hill, SC first examines the condition of your teeth via x-ray and then administers a local anesthetic. After numbing the tooth, the dentist begins to isolate the tooth via a small protective sheet called a dental-dam. Afterward, a small opening is made in the crown of the tooth and the hole is used to clean the canals. Once the canal is clean & shaped, it is then filled with a rubber-like material known as "gutta-percha" and sealer. The opening is then closed due to a temporary filling. This prevents microbes from entering the canal & re-infecting the tooth.

The ultimate outcome of a root canal is long-lasting & relieves you from the pain to a certain extent so that you can enjoy your favorite meal easily. Above and beyond, the exclusive benefit of root canal treatment is that you get to keep your tooth. It is better than extraction because extraction can sometimes cause other dental problems such as drifting of teeth.
